Beyond the Token Economy

Traditional arcades operate on a model of fleeting engagement, where each play session is measured by the clink of a token. The monthly plan dismantles this economy entirely. For a fixed, reasonable fee, the barrier of the coin slot is removed, allowing for a deeper and more strategic form of play. Without the constant pressure of “making every credit count,” players are free to experiment, to fail spectacularly, and to learn from their mistakes. This fosters a unique environment where skill development is prioritized over sheer luck or momentary reaction. It turns a casual visit into a dedicated training ground, where one can master the intricate combos of a fighting game or memorize the spawn points in a classic shooter without the anxiety of a dwindling pocket.

Curating the Collection

One of the most compelling features of the monthly plan is the dynamic nature of the game library. The collection is not static; it is a carefully curated rotation that pays homage to the golden age of arcades while embracing the innovations of the modern indie scene. A member might spend the first weekend of the month immersed in the vector graphics of a 1980s classic, only to find the lineup refreshed with a newly released beat-’em-up the following week. This rotation ensures that the experience never grows stale. It encourages players to step outside their comfort zones, to try genres they might otherwise ignore, and to appreciate the evolution of game design from simple geometric shapes to complex, narrative-driven experiences, all while feeling the cool breeze of the night air.
